Pet's info: Dog | Chihuahua | Female | 2 months and 2 days old
Hi I saw a chihuahua puppy today and it had gunky eyes, both pups I saw had gunky eyes so it wasn't just the 1 pup around their eyes were slightly crispy and one had greenish yellowish mucus on its eye ! Could this be something simple or could this be a real bad sign ? Noses looked wet, pups smelt of poo a bit so maybe not kept in a clean environment, only 8 weeks old ! Could this be really bad ? I couldn't get very good photos but the pups otherwise look ok and last pic is of mum who looked ok

These puppies probably have an upper respiratory tract infection and/or infectious conjunctivitis. Usually a course of antibiotics (topical for the eye and oral) will take care of the issue. I hope this helps. Thanks for using Petco Pet Education Center, formerly Petcoach. Best of luck.
